X-Git-Url: https://git.phdru.name/?a=blobdiff_plain;f=parser%2Ftest_parser.py;h=df24b06f648d1802da91be985e552556345c8d98;hb=e34c70c04914c3884b0a474956edf36496038533;hp=67c0ae3fc848e0a95df1a47e3c2387017b7d7491;hpb=3db3a1c52868d865cac4e96d6521f62feb15cf77;p=phdru.name%2Fcgi-bin%2Fblog-ru%2Fsearch-tags.git diff --git a/parser/test_parser.py b/parser/test_parser.py index 67c0ae3..df24b06 100755 --- a/parser/test_parser.py +++ b/parser/test_parser.py @@ -1,7 +1,7 @@ #! /usr/bin/env python import unittest -from ometa.runtime import ParseError +from lark import LexError, ParseError from parser import parse class TestParser(unittest.TestCase): @@ -12,7 +12,7 @@ class TestParser(unittest.TestCase): self.assertEqual(self._parse('xxx'), ('NAME', 'xxx')) def test_03_bad_tag(self): - self.assertRaises(ParseError, self._parse, 'XXX') + self.assertRaises(LexError, self._parse, 'XXX') def test_04_expression(self): self.assertEqual(self._parse('!(xxx&yyy)'),